Abstract

The invention discloses a bent-torsional component welding method. The method comprises the following steps: a guide wheel is additionally mounted on one side of a submerged arc welding car, and the submerged arc welding car added with the guide wheel is in spot welding connection with a magnetic sucking car; the bottoming and the filling welding are performed on bent-torsional components by using first preset welding parameters; and the submerged arc welding car and the magnetic sucking car in spot welding connection are used for performing the cover surface welding on the bent-torsional components after the bottoming and the filling welding, so that the welding efficiency is improved, and the appearance molding of cover surface welding lines is guaranteed.

Description

technical field [0001] The invention relates to the field of welding technology, in particular to a welding method for twisted members. Background technique [0002] Due to the structural characteristics of the torsion member, when welding the main weld of the traditional torsion member, the CO2 gas shielded welding method should be used to prime and fill the torsion member. When the torsion member has no slope or the slope is not greater than 4°, it can be used When the submerged arc welding method is used to cover the surface, when the slope is greater than 4°, the gas shielded welding method must be used to cover the surface. However, using the gas shielded welding method to cover the surface will reduce the welding efficiency and it is difficult to ensure the appearance of the cover weld.
